What does Commonwealth Fusion Systems use on the backend and infrastructure?
The strongest public backend signal is Python · C++ · scientific computing. Infrastructure appears oriented around AWS/HPC and simulation infrastructure signals, with heavy use of engineering, simulation, telemetry, manufacturing, or mission systems rather than conventional web-app-only infrastructure.
Because Commonwealth Fusion Systems is a fusion energy company, the critical path is high-temperature superconducting magnets. Vendors should assume integrations must respect uptime, safety, traceability, and technical validation requirements.

What Commonwealth Fusion Systems's stack means if you sell to them
Integration and displacement pitches should start with the detected stack, not generic transformation language. The most credible wedge is a narrow workflow that improves reliability, traceability, simulation speed, manufacturing quality, deployment safety, customer delivery, or compliance.
Expect build-versus-buy scrutiny. These companies employ strong engineers, so vendors need a clear reason the external product beats internal tooling on time-to-value, support burden, auditability, and total cost.
